Output dd530b796a0d31af3214b7ff3a5162676fd15d51ee0b91777f90e0b43c7ee474:1

value
726860
script pubkey
OP_0 OP_PUSHBYTES_20 3a77055c6cf67de7cd3deaab9376975150f866e3
address
bc1q8fms2hrv7e770nfaa24exa5h29g0sehr9893tv
transaction
dd530b796a0d31af3214b7ff3a5162676fd15d51ee0b91777f90e0b43c7ee474
spent
true